Gabriele Gori
Gabriele Gori (born 13 February 1999) is an Italian footballer who plays as a forward for Serie B club Südtirol on loan from Avellino. Club careerFiorentinaHe is a product of Fiorentina youth squads and started playing for their Under-19 team in the 2016–17 season.[2] Late in the 2017–18 Serie A season, he made some appearances on the bench for Fiorentina's senior team, but did not see any time on the field.[3] Loan to FoggiaOn 16 July 2018, he joined Serie B club Foggia on a season-long loan.[4] He made his Serie B debut for Foggia on 26 August 2018 in a game against Carpi as a starter.[5] He played 9 league games for Foggia in the first part of the season, 3 of them as a starter. Loan to LivornoOn 31 January 2019, he moved on another Serie B loan to Livorno.[6] Loan to ArezzoOn 2 September 2019, he joined Arezzo on loan.[7] Loan to VicenzaOn 1 September 2020, he was loaned to Vicenza.[8] Loan to CosenzaOn 13 August 2021, he went to Cosenza on loan.[9] AvellinoOn 28 August 2023, Gori signed a three-year contract with Avellino.[10] Loan to SüdtirolOn 31 January 2025, Gori moved to Südtirol on loan with an option to buy.[11] International careerHe was first called up to represent his country in February 2014 for an Italy national under-15 football team friendly.[12] After playing more friendlies for the Under-16 squad, he made appearances for the Under-17 team in the 2016 UEFA European Under-17 Championship qualification, mostly as late substitute.[13] He was not included in the final tournament squad. For the Under-19 squad, he again made several late-substitute appearances in the 2018 UEFA European Under-19 Championship qualification, but was not included in the final tournament squad.[14] References
